In mid-May, CYDA asked more than 200 young people with disability, and their parents or caregivers, to share their thoughts on the NDIS eligibility reassessment process.
Nearly one in four of those surveyed had received an eligibility reassessment letter in the last six months, and a majority were parents of children aged nine or under.
Almost half (48%) of these were removed from the Scheme, or had their funding reduced or services cut, as a result.
In this summary factsheet of our findings, we outline the top issues identified by respondents and their suggestions for improvement.
Their concerns included:
- The removal and loss of supports without clear reasons
- The process feeling unfair or unreasonable
- The process being unclear and confusing
- Poor treatment by NDIS staff
- A severe emotional toll
